Excerpt from City Planning Housing, Vol. 2: Political Economy and Civic Art

Our fathers and forefathers believed implicitly in liberty as the unfailing boon and saviour in every emergency: in economic liberty which means free competition; in political liberty which means democracy, both of which, however, are helpless without some form of national planning - a basic conception of the American Constitution. It was this faith that gave our fathers inspiration and strength for mighty achievements. They marched forwards and upwards in almost every field of science, of economics, of culture. Today this faith is considered to be mere delusion. Yet with its disappearance there vanished both strength and prosperity and we stand today aghast, confronted with the possible downfall of our civilization, faced with the prospect of falling back into poverty, servitude and barbarism. Yet there is one shining ray Of hope which, if we grasp it, can prevent the imminent cataclysm. This hope lies in a rationally planned society rather than in a growth of purely natural forces.
